Sheridan Co. uses the percentage-of-receivables basis to record bad debt expense. It estimates that 1% of accounts receivable will become uncollectible. Accounts receivable are $428,000 at the end of the year, and the allowance for doubtful accounts has a credit balance of $2,100. (a) Your answer has been saved. See score details after the due date. Prepare the adjusting journal entry to record bad debt expense for the year. (Credit account titles are automatically indented when amount is entered. Do not indent manually.) Account Titles and Explanation Debit Credit Bad Debt Expense 2180 Allowance for Doubtful Accounts 2180 List of Accounts Attempts: 1 of 1 used (b) If the allowance for doubtful accounts had a debit balance of $850 instead of a credit balance of $2,100, determine the amount to be reported for bad debt expense.
